Anna is one of seven puppies of Ava 11-088. She is the only female of the litter and is golden in color and looks just like her mother.
She and her brothers came up from Missouri last weekend, saved from euthanasia by RAGOM. They were dumped at the Joplin Humane Society who couldn't handle them due to overcrowding. We have no history on her but as we learn about her we'll certainly fill you in.
Today she weighs six point eight pounds and has gotten her first vet visit. Like her mother she wants human contact. Like her siblings she is mellow. And she is as cute as the dickens.
